Transaction 089576cb00a45716ca8a04ba04e3d55ba3b8fe852a1b3b164dff14104a36f04a
1 Input
1 Output
-
089576cb00a45716ca8a04ba04e3d55ba3b8fe852a1b3b164dff14104a36f04a:0
- value
- 2144692
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a38c0fd75bf89a78dca1a1cd24bd00aa0373205 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DbrEoRgvbDCgsikeX5kQdmgnNMtUTYxfV